140144313035 has 4 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 168173175648. Its totient is φ = 112115450424.

The previous prime is 140144313031. The next prime is 140144313059. The reversal of 140144313035 is 530313441041.

It is a happy number.

It is a semiprime because it is the product of two primes.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 140144313035 - 22 = 140144313031 is a prime.

It is a super-2 number, since 2×1401443130352 (a number of 23 digits) contains 22 as substring.

It is a Duffinian number.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 140144312989 and 140144313007.

It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(140144313031)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 14014431299 + ... + 14014431308.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(42043293912).

Almost surely, 2140144313035 is an apocalyptic number.

140144313035 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(28028862613).

140144313035 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

140144313035 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The sum of its prime factors is 28028862612.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 8640, while the sum is 29.

Adding to 140144313035 its reverse (530313441041), we get a palindrome (670457754076).
